How much does a j2ee developer earn in El Segundo, CA?
The average j2ee developer in El Segundo, CA earns between $77,000 and $139,000 annually. This compares to the national average j2ee developer range of $69,000 to $116,000.
Average j2ee developer salary in El Segundo, CA
$104,000
